A group of five male voice actors, Kumagai Kentaro, Komatsu Shouhei, Terashima Junta, Nakamura Shugo, and Fukamachi Toshinari, known as “GOALOUS5”, has started a2D-character project, which was announced at “Voice and Fortune Training-Emergency Call! Report of Serious Operations” broadcast on Jul. 12, 2020. At the same time, the production of the second theme song and the release of new goods has also been announced.

“GOALOUS5” is a group of five male voice actors, the concept of which are dark heroes, who aim for “world voice fortune (conquest)” by making people captivated by the power of their voices.
From May 22, 2019, the WEB program “GOALOUS5's GO5 Channel” featuring members, Kumagai Kentaro, Komatsu Shouhei, Terashima Junta, Nakamura Shugo, and Fukamachi Toshinari, has been streamed on YouTube and Nico Nico Douga.

On Jul. 12, during “Voice Training-Emergency Call! Report of a serious operation”, “GOALOUS 5” had announced the start of a new project where they will become 2D-characters.
Character design will be handled by Natsuo, who is famous for the character design in such works, as “BAKUMATSU”, “DREAM!ing”, “VAZZROCK”, and others, and on the “GO5 Channel,” on Jul, 15, five people will discuss the character settings.

Moreover, after the first theme song “GO5 GOALOUS5” released in Nov. 2019, the second theme song CD will be released.
It has been used as background music since the “GO5 channel” broadcast from Jul. 8, so please, check it out.
Also, the 2nd volume of the Gora Sword acrylic key chain and the “GOALOUS Metamorphose Bag (Reversible Tote Bag)” simple bag made with a simple design on one side and the member's color design on the reverse side, will be released at the first offline event “Seifu Dai Daisaku Shushu! GOALOUS5!”.

Detailed information about the release date and complete version of the second theme song CD will be announced later. New goods will be on sale at the GCRE store.
